Directions to See a Ghost is the second album from Texas rock band The Black Angels. It was released digitally on April 15, 2008, and on CD on May 13th. Those who purchased the album digitally were given a download code to be used to download the album, and which was to be brought back to the place of purchase on or after the date of release to be given the hard copy of the album as well as a bonus four-song EP Black Angel Exit.
The group have signed to the label Suretone, owned by Interscope, for releases after this album.
Prefix Magazine called it "an easy candidate for one of the best records of the year".
